    Abstract: Abstract: This study focus on using surface response method to optimize the taurine analysis by capillary electrophoresis with contactless conductivity detector. A response surface method (RSM) coupled with a central composite model (CCD) comprising 30 experiments was developed with 4 factors including concentration of Tris buffer, pH value, separating potential and sample injection time. The best set of factor levels for taurine analysis was found as follows: 150 mmol/L of Tris concentration, pH = 8.96, separation voltage of -10 kV, the sample injection time of 60 seconds. The validation of analytical method showed the detection limit for taurine was 0.266mg/L, linearity range from 1 to 500 mg/L, relative standard deviation values ​​for peak areas and migration times were less than 3.16%, the linear correlation coefficient gained 0.999. Recovery efficiency of taurine in several food supplement matrixes such as: fresh milk, milk powder, energy drink were in range from 91.9% to 101.7%.

    Abstract: "Electric shock" is the term used only when the current flows through the body. In addition to the tremendous benefits of social life, electricity also has serious economic consequences, which can be fatal to human life without understanding and non-compliance with the safeguards in living and living produce. We collected 37 victims died of electric shock with medical examination records by the Department of Forensic Medicine - Hanoi Medical University and the Military Institute of Forensic Medicine during the time from May/ 2001 to 7/2016. Results: The male/female ratio was 8,3. The average age was 36,6 the highest proportion is group of age 18-30 (37,8%). Most of the victims were 78,4%, mostly electrical sign at 78,4%, the highest frequency occurred in the right hand 29,7%.

    Abstract: The optimized capillary electrophoresis (CE) was applied to separate and detect the 10-hydroxy-2-decenoic acid (10-HAD) in royal jelly products. The method only requires that the sample solution need to be centrifuged and filtered before analyzed by the home-made capillary electrophoresis system. Firstly, 10-HDA was separated in a fused silica column with a diameter of 50 um using 20 mM Tris/Acetic buffer (pH 8.5) as a background electrolyte and a separation voltage of -17kV. Then, 10-HDA was detected by capacitively coupled contactless conductivity detection (C4D) with the migration time less than 8 minutes. Nine commercial products of royal jelly with Vietnamese and imported origin including pure royal jelly cream, lyophilized royal jelly (powder and gel) and honey with royal jelly were collected for analysis. The results of this study showed that content of 10-HDA were detected in the range of 0.5 mg/g to 23.1 mg/g. Using paired t test showed that the difference between results obtained from CE-C4D method and from HPLC method as a reference method was not statistically significant.     Abstract: Fe68Pd32 nanoparticles were prepared by sonoelectrodeposition with subsequent annealing at 600 oC for a series of times from 1 h to 6 h. The annealing transformed disordered face-centered cubic (fcc) phase in the as-prepared samples into a multi-phase material containing an ordered L10 FePd, fcc FePd and body-centered cubic (bcc) Fe phases. After annealing at 600°C for 6 h the hard magnetic phase L10-FePd and soft magnetic fcc-FePd phase coexist. The structural and magnetic properties of the samples were studied in dependence of annealing time. The decrease of coercivity with increasing annealing time from 1 h to 4 h is suggested to occur by formation of multi-L10 domain particles, while the increase of coercivity with increasing annealing time from 4 h to 6 h is proposed due to the multiphase nature of the nanoparticles samples.

    Abstract: Yeast has long been considered to be one of the main subjects of the food industry. Yeast has the ability to absorb and assimilate zinc to creating a group of zinc – enriched yeast products, which are source of functional products with high nutritional value, ensuring food safety. In this study, we examined, selected some conditions that affected the uptake of zinc – enriched yeast biomass by Saccharomyces pastorianus CNTP 4054 with high level of zinc accumulation. This strain was from strains collection in the Center of Industrial Microbiology, in Food Industries Research Institute. Suitable fermentation conditions for zinc – enrich biomass by strain Saccharomyces pastorianus CNTP 4054 were glucose – 200g/L, yeast extract – 50g/L, ZnSO4 – 750mg/L, fermented at 30°C for 72 Hour, input value pH = 7.

    Abstract: The Mekong River mouth has a significance of biodiversity and biological resources, especially for the floating and benthic communities in the ecosystem. The study area belongs to 4 provinces in the lower Mekong River: Tien Giang, Tra Vinh, Ben Tre, and Soc Trang. The results of Shannon-Wiener biodiversity value assessment and Berger - Parke index of 3 major aquatic communities in the area including phytoplankton, zooplankton and benthic showing that biodiversity at low levels in terms of species composition as well as biodiversity values. More noteworthy is that the benthic animal communities are at the highest level of risk of loss and biodiversity value loss, mainly due to socio-economic activities, dams construction activities, the industrial and agricultural activities that have made the environment here, especially the sediment environment, strongly affected. The study has proposed a number of solutions to minimize the rapid decline of biodiversity of the region by specific measures from many directions: management, education, propaganda, conservation, prevention of the factors affecting the quality of ecosystem in the region.

    Abstract: Cloud detection is a significant task in optical remote sensing to reconstruct the contaminated cloud area from multi-temporal satellite images. Besides, the rapid development of machine learning techniques, especially deep learning algorithms, can detect clouds over a large area in optical remote sensing data. In this study, the method based on the proposed deep-learning method called ODC-Cloud, which was built on convolutional blocks and integrating with the Open Data Cube (ODC) platform. The results showed that our proposed model achieved an overall 90% accuracy in detecting cloud in Landsat 8 OLI imagery and successfully integrated with the ODC to perform multi-scale and multi-temporal analysis. This is a pioneer study in techniques of storing and analyzing big optical remote sensing data.

    Abstract: Edaravone (EDV, 3-methyl-1-phenyl-2-pyrazolin-5-one) is a neuroprotective drug that has been used to treat acute stroke caused by cerebral thrombosis and embolism. Studies showed that EDV could be used to treat diseases related to oxidizing agents; however, the activity has not been fully studied yet. In this study, the free radical scavenging activity of EDV was investigated by thermodynamic and kinetic calculations. The results showed that EDV exhibited good HOO• radical scavenging activity in an aqueous medium at pH = 7.40 (koverall(HOO) = 8.58´107 M-1 s-1) through the electron transfer mechanism of the anion state. In contrast, this activity was insignificant in non-polar environments. EDV also exhibited excellent antiradical activity against HO·, CH3O·, CH3OO·, O2·-, NO2, SO4·-, N3· and DPPH radicals in the aqueous solution. Thus, it appears to suggest that EDV is a promising radical scavenger in polar environments.

    Abstract: Abstract: The estrogen-α (ER-α) receptor is an important target in breast cancer therapy. Alkaloids are a class of plant extracts that have the potential to inhibit ER-α receptors. In this study, we evaluated the ability of alkaloids to inhibit ER-α receptors by molecular docking method. Based on previous publications, we collected 52 alkaloid compounds. The results showed that there were 4 compounds with stronger inhibitory effects on ER-α receptors than positive controls, which are co-crystallized ligands with 4-hydroxytamoxifen. Conducting analysis according to Lipinski's 5-criteria rule and predicting pharmacokinetic-toxicological parameters, we obtained one compound with drug-like properties is Pityriacitrin B. Therefore, this compound has the potential to develop into drugs that inhibit ER-α receptors for breast cancer treatment. Keywords: Breast cancer, ER-α, molecular docking, alkaloid, Pityriacitrin B.

    Abstract: Micro/nano urchin-like VO2 particles were synthesized successfully by hydrothermal method. Vanadium pentoxide (V2O5), oxalic acid (C2H2O4) and sodium dodecyl sulfate (SDS) surfactant were used as reagents for the synthesis of VO2. In this article, we have reported the synthesis procedure of VO2 nanorods and micro/nano urchin-like VO2 structure and evaluating the methylene blue (MB) adsorption properties. Morphology and particle size of VO2 were observed by FE-SEM. The phase formation of VO2 was studied by XRD. Raman spectroscopy was also used for characterization of VO2. Micro/nano urchin-like VO2 structure was showed good MB adsorption properties that have potential applications in dye-contaminated water treatments.
